Canadian National Railway Company
(
CNI
) co-partnered with Indiana Rail Road Company (INRD) to set up an
intermodal terminal in Indianapolis.
Located near INRD's existing Senate Avenue Terminal, the new unit
is in downtown Indianapolis and adjacent to Lucas Oil Stadium.
The terminal, which will also have a container yard as well as
agricultural products export loading platform, is currently being
constructed and is scheduled to be operational from June, this
year. The facility will provide importers and exporters of the
state of Indiana with an all rail transportation option for
products moving to and coming from Asia in crates.
According to Canadian National Railway, this all rail service
will benefit Indiana importers by cutting down the transit times
and offering consistent transportation, leading to smooth supply
chains connectivity. The imported goods from China and Korea are
expected to arrive at the Senate Avenue Terminal within 18-20
days via this new service unit.
Privately held INRD stated that this direct-west coast intermodal
service will clear much of the bottleneck that importers faced in
the past and will offer steady, regular and environmentally
friendly hauling of cargo.
Montreal, Canada based Canadian National Railway is in constant
attempt to improve its railroading (velocity, reliability, lowers
costs and asset utilization) standards. The company plans to
invest over $1 billion towards track and infrastructure
improvement as well as productivity initiatives.
Recently, the company initiated operations at Calgary Logistics
Park with the opening of a new intermodal terminal. Through this
new intermodal service, the park is made available for shipping
consumer as well as industrial products.
